Alcatel-Lucent Opens up Award-Winning GPON Platform to Third-Party Optical Network Terminals


PARIS - BROADBAND WORLD FORUM EUROPE, September 7 /PRNewswire/ --

- Allowing Service Providers to Create True Multi-Vendor GPON Networks, 
Without Operational Challenges

Alcatel-Lucent (Euronext Paris and NYSE: ALU) today announced
it is taking a major step to help service providers create a true
multi-vendor gigabit passive optical networking (GPON) infrastructure, by
publishing its "OMCI Interoperability Implementer's Guide - Version 1". Using
this guide, optical network terminal (ONT) vendors will gain insights in
Alcatel-Lucent's ONT management and control interfaces (OMCI), which they can
then integrate in their own terminals to interoperate with Alcatel-Lucent's
extensive, embedded base of GPON central office equipment.

Service providers will thus be able to benefit from a more
competitive ONT environment and a huge choice of third-party ONT models
working seamlessly with Alcatel-Lucent's flagship GPON product, the 7342 ISAM
FTTU. This will translate into faster time-to-market, fewer engineering
constraints and a reduced need for interop events. For ONT vendors, this will
mean new business opportunities and less OPEX by having less interoperability
events.

"Alcatel-Lucent is taking a bold step by being the first GPON
player to share its OMCI specifications with other vendors. Our goal is to
encourage the adoption of fiber-to-the-home by breaking down interoperability
barriers," comments Dave Geary, President of Alcatel-Lucent's wireline
networks activities. "Alcatel-Lucent will shortly be publishing its OMCI
Version-1, and is even prepared to go a step further - by making its full
OMCI available to its partners on a case-by-case basis."

Alcatel-Lucent is currently involved in over 95 FTTH projects
worldwide, over 80 of which are with GPON. Additionally, Alcatel-Lucent's
GPON network has been deployed by a considerable number of utility companies
as well as municipalities and regions around the world. In Gartner's latest
FTTH Magic Quadrant assessment1, Alcatel-Lucent was positioned in the leaders
quadrant for the fiber-to-the-home space.
